Description

Hoisting equipment of steel construction
Technical Field
The utility model relates to the technical field of steel structures, in particular to hoisting equipment for a steel structure.
Background
When the mill carries out work, demand for work occasionally, the workman need carry some heavier steel, because steel piles up very inconvenient in carrying on subaerial, sometimes perhaps injure the foot of oneself by a crashing object in addition, the potential safety hazard has been brought for workman's work, do not also do not help to improve work efficiency, the workman is in with the help of traditional small-size lifting device, traditional small-size lifting device single structure, the flexibility is poor, often can only carry out work in a direction, stability is also poor, often when carrying heavier steel, set up and produce the slope easily, make equipment bend, be unfavorable for using widely.

Detailed Description
Referring to fig. 1-4, the present invention provides a technical solution: hoisting equipment of steel construction includes: the base 1 and the rotating mechanism 3, the base 1 is a solid structure, the bottom of the base 1 is provided with a box body 2, the top of the base 1 is provided with a hoisting mechanism 4, the outer walls of two sides of the box body 2 are respectively provided with a group of supporting mechanisms 5, the rotating mechanism 3 is arranged on the box body 2, the rotating mechanism 3 comprises a support 301, a motor 302, gears 303 and a turntable 304, the outer wall of one side of a bracket of the box body 2 is fixedly provided with the support 301, the support 301 is fixedly provided with the motor 302, the bottom and the top of the interior of the box body 2 are respectively and rotatably provided with two groups of gears 303, the two groups of gears 303 are mutually meshed to realize rotation, an output shaft of the motor 302 extends into the box body 2 through a coupler and is fixedly arranged with a central shaft of one group of the gears 303, the turntable 304 is rotatably arranged at the top of the box body 2, the central shaft of the turntable 304 extends into the interior of the box body 2 and is fixedly arranged with a central shaft of one group of the gears 303, the top fixed mounting of carousel 304 has base 1, when the workman will pile up steel subaerial and hoist, piles up steel subaerial all directions for can hoist, carousel 304 can rotate base 1 to different position according to workman's different demands, has not only improved lifting device's flexibility, also makes the convenient steel that will be located in some corners of workman hoist.
Further, the hoisting mechanism 4 comprises a second motor 401, a belt pulley 402, a steel wire rope 403, a first telescopic rod 404, a first pulley 405, a second pulley 406 and a hanging ring 407, the second motor 401 is fixedly installed at the top of the base 1, the belt pulley 402 is fixedly installed at an output shaft of the second motor 401, the steel wire rope 403 is installed on the belt pulley 402 in a sleeved mode, the first telescopic rod 404 is installed at the top of the base 1 in a hinged mode, the first pulley 405 is fixedly installed above the outer wall of the free end of the first telescopic rod 404, the second pulley 406 is fixedly installed at the end face of the free end of the first telescopic rod 404, the hanging ring 407 is fixedly installed at one end of the steel wire rope 403, the steel wire rope 403 is sleeved on the first pulley 405 and the second pulley 406, the supporting mechanism 5 comprises a hydraulic cylinder 501, a sliding rail 502, a sliding seat 503, a supporting plate 504 and a supporting rod 505, mounting seats are arranged on the outer walls of two sides of the box body 2, a group of the mounting seats are fixedly installed on a group of the hydraulic cylinders 501, the outer walls of two sides of the box body 2 are fixedly provided with a set of slide rails 502, the two sets of slide rails 502 are respectively provided with a set of slide bases 503 in a sliding manner, the bottoms of the two sets of slide bases 503 are respectively fixedly provided with a set of support plates 504, the outer walls of the two sets of support plates 504 are respectively fixedly provided with a set of support rods 505, one ends of the two sets of support rods 505 are respectively fixedly provided at the bottoms of the two sets of slide bases 503, the outer wall of one side of the base 1 is hinged with a second telescopic rod 8, the lower part of the outer wall of the free end of the first telescopic rod 404 is fixedly provided with a second slide rail 6, the second slide base 7 is slidably provided on the second slide rail 6, the free end of the second telescopic rod 8 is hinged with the end surface of the second slide base 7, in order to keep the free end of the first telescopic rod 404 stable when hoisting steel at a distance, the free end of the second telescopic rod 8 can stretch with the first telescopic rod 404 to stretch and stretch, thereby playing a role of stabilizing the first telescopic rod 404, base 1's bottom fixed mounting has balancing weight 9, and balancing weight 9 can increase lifting device's weight, prevents lifting device, when the weight of hoisting some remote and steel is heavier, takes place to incline and collapses, and fixed mounting has the universal pulley of multiunit on box 2's the support, conveniently removes lifting device.
The working principle is as follows: when workers need to hoist the steel accumulated on the ground, the hoisting equipment can be moved to a proper position in advance, the free end of the first telescopic rod 404 is firstly stretched to a proper length, then the free end of the second telescopic rod 8 is properly extended to a proper position, the free end of the second telescopic rod 8 supports the free end of the first telescopic rod 404, the second motor 401 is started, the second motor 401 drives the belt pulley 402 to do slow rotation motion, the lifting ring 407 on the steel wire rope 403 lifts or descends steel, the motor 302 is started, the motor 302 drives one of the gears 303 to rotate, the two gears 303 are meshed with each other to realize rotation, then one of the gears 303 drives the turntable 304 to rotate to adjust the orientation of the base 1, in addition, the hydraulic cylinder 501 is activated, and the free end of the hydraulic cylinder 501 extends and retracts to support the support plate 504 on the ground.
